Determine the slope of the line that passes through the points (-4, 6) and (0,4).
gavmur [86]

Answer:

B.) m=-\frac{1}{2}

Step-by-step explanation:

use the slope rule

\frac{rise}{run} \\\\\\frac{y2-y1}{x2-x1}

Fill in values

\frac{4-6}{0-(-4)}

Simplify

\frac{-2}{4}\\-\frac{2}{4}

Simplify further

m=-\frac{1}{2}

Michael and Kathryn bowl together and their combined total score for one game was 425points. Michael’s score was 70 less than tw
In-s [12.5K]

Hey there!

Let us take Michael's score as ' x '

Let us take Kathryn's score as ' y '

Michael - 70 less than twice Kathryn's


x = 2y - 70

y = y

Add them, we get , 425

2y - 70 + y = 425

3y - 70 = 425

3y = 495

y = 495/3

y = 165

Kathryn's score = 165

Michael - 2 ( 165 ) - 70

= 260
